- >Supra 28.8 internal fax modem shipped with new micron system. Sales
- >person did not seem to know much more than this re: said modem.
- >Question, is the Supra 28.8 line a good reliable choice? I could
- >exclude it from order & purchase another brand? USR ? Thanks in
- >advance for your input.
-
- If it is the *good* supra 28.8, the "SupraFAXModem", then get it. If it
- is the "Express" model, then exclude it, perhaps to purchase the
- non-Express (and non-"Simple Internet"; thats an Express with software),
- or maybe a Cardinal. I would recommend against USR as an alternate brand,
- however.
